Amarillo’s National Weather Service reported yesterday morning that rainfall totals over the previous last 48 hours had averaged 1-4 inches across much of the area, with the highest amounts extending from the SW Texas Panhandle northeast toward the north central Panhandle.

WASHINGTON—U.S. Rep. Mac Thornberry, R-Clarendon, announced Monday that he will not seek reelection in 2020, making him the sixth GOP congressman from Texas to say he’s retiring in recent weeks.
